### Account Recovery — Catalogue Import (Lintwood)

Quick one for review: when the Lintwood catalogue import wipes a patron's session table, the recovery flow re-seeds accounts from the nightly snapshot. Check that the importer skips locked accounts — last time it didn't. To rerun recovery against staging you'll need the vault passphrase, which is appended just below.

recovery phrase for yafof-tajof: julmir-kelax-julvan-holath-belvan-holir-ralael-ralvan-ralath-julvan-silmir-istmir-kaswyn-ulamir

Branch managers: the Kestrelline reseller programme underperformed in two of five regions. Margins held at target elsewhere. Onboarding time remains the main complaint; training materials are being rewritten by the Pellford team. Tier thresholds will change next quarter — do not communicate this externally yet. Expect updated partner contracts within six weeks. Field questions to your regional lead, not resellers. Hold all tier-change conversations until sign-off. The confidential plan detail follows below.

board note of bawep-tajef: Queniusek Systems plans to raise the Quenvan list price by 53.1 percent in March. The pricing group signed off on a budget of $176.4 million for Project Drueth. The renewal with Casionix Partners closes at $142.5 million a year, 8.3 percent below the last contract. Project Fraax slips by six weeks because of the tooling delay.

// REINDEX_BATCH_CAP limits docs per shard pass in the Tallowfield
// nightly search reindex. Raising it starves the ingest queue;
// lowering it overruns the maintenance window. 5000 is the tested
// sweet spot. Change only with a soak run. Verified against the
// build noted below.

session token of bawif-hahog = htk6_ac5981

**Ticket QX-2214: Tame the firehose from NotifyGnome**

Hey Priya — NotifyGnome is spamming roughly 40k debug lines per minute into the aggregator, and it's burying actual errors during peak hours. Proposal: drop to 1-in-50 sampling for debug, keep warn/error at full volume. Marek already patched the sampler config and it held up fine in staging overnight. Ready to ride along with Thursday's cut. The trace token for the staging verification run is below.

build token for kagaf-hahof: htk14_9d3d4d26d7d8de